TL;DR Summary

Following the sudden fall of the Assad regime in Syria, representatives of the country's Catholic community express hope for a democratic rebirth. Despite Assad's portrayal as a protector of minorities, many Christians welcome the change, citing exhaustion under his rule. Rebel forces have shown increasing tolerance towards Christians, and leaders like Archbishop Hanna Jallouf have received assurances of safety. The international community is urged to help stabilize Syria and support the development of a new constitution that respects all rights.
